Description

Explores how the USHMM and other museums and memorials both displace and disturb the memories that they are trying to commemorate.

Author Biography:

Michael Bernard-Donals is Nancy Hoefs Professor of English at the University of Wisconsin-Madison. His books include Forgetful Memory: Representation and Remembrance in the Wake of the Holocaust, also published by SUNY Press, and Jewish Rhetorics: History, Theory, Practice (coedited with Janice W. Fernheimer).
